Job Title :- Control System Engineer
Location Warminster, PA

Note:- Client or iFix or SCADA experience combine with Allen Bradly and Siemens PLC is must have


Job Description & Skill Requirement

Responsibilities:
• Develop, test, troubleshoot, modify, and commission Allen Bradley PLC (CompactLogix) control system applications using RSLogix.
• Develop, test, troubleshoot, modify, and commission SCADA and Client Proficy HMI/SCADA (iFIX) control system applications.
• Specify and purchase control system hardware and instrumentation.
• Read, understand, develop, and modify control system design documents including diagrams, drawings (P&ID, control system schematics, wiring drawings, I/O lists, pneumatic and hydraulic drawings, etc.) and written design specifications (Functional Specifications, Users Manuals, Sequence of Operations, etc.).
• Produce GAMP documentation including, but not limited to, Functional Specifications (FS), Hardware Design Specifications (HDS), and Software Design Specifications (SDS) as required by project specifications.
• Develop, modify, and configure PC based relational databases.
• Develop and install control systems in a cost effective and timely manner in accordance with project schedules, budgets, customer requirements, and equipment specifications.
• Report on and/or present progress and status of projects and assignments in various formats to internal and external audiences.
• Perform value analysis and sustaining engineering tasks, and product improvement designs to enhance manufacturability, productivity, reliability, safety, quality, and cost effectiveness.
• Aid Technical Support and Service personnel.
• Some travel to other SP facilities, vendors, or customer sites may be necessary. Some travel may be foreign.
• Strong project management skills with a track record of successful project delivery.
• Knowledge of automation technologies, Allen Bradley PLCs and I/O, Siemens PLCS and I/O, Client iFIX SCADA systems, FactoryTalk View ME HMIs, and industrial communication protocols.
• Software: Studio5000, FactoryTalk View ME, Siemens TIA Portal.
• Familiarity with regulatory requirements and standards in the pharmaceutical industry.
• Computer skills to include Microsoft Office products-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Project.
• Experience with capital equipment or engineered-to-order products is required.
• Experience with validation procedures and change-control practices relating to control system development and modification is a plus.
• Experience with controls validation and change-control procedures within an FDA regulated environment is a plus.
• Experience with computer-based Bills of Material and Inventory Control processes and MRP is a plus.
• Experience with systems integration involving multiple vendors is a plus.
• Experience with refrigeration systems control is a plus.
• Experience designing, troubleshooting IP networks
• Must have good troubleshooting skills.
•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to collaborate effectively with cross-functional teams.


Qualification:
• Bachelor’s degree in electrical engineering or a related field.
• Minimum of 8-10 years in a leadership role within automation engineering, preferably in the pharmaceutical or related industry.
